Output dd4b0c53264543ba0b6ec33a38e2d0385d44d25d224b1c27c1ce5949eec03432: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d136cf84f225a382c408fc73bc35e5f84f26391 OP_EQUAL
address
3MqxXf4dAWHzY449iT26UaS16tQSiTwKfa
transaction
dd4b0c53264543ba0b6ec33a38e2d0385d44d25d224b1c27c1ce5949eec03432
confirmations
321090
spent
true